The Epithets of Fatima Zahra (A.S.): A Glimpse into Her Majesty
Fatima Zahra (A.S.) was esteemed as the daughter of Prophet Muhammad (PBUH), and her name resonates with profound significance in Islamic history and tradition. The epithets bestowed upon her illuminate her magnificent virtues and serve as a testament to her unparalleled spiritual standing.
She is revered as "Sayyidat al-Nisa" (Lady of Women), signifying her preeminence over all women, both in this world and the hereafter. Her unwavering faith, impeccable piety, and profound wisdom have earned her the title "Siddiqa," that denoted "The Truthful" – a testament to her sincerity and alignment with divine guidance.
Fatima Zahra (A.S.) was known for her unwavering devotion to Islam, her absolute commitment to justice, and her compassionate heart. These distinctive qualities have made her an enduring source of inspiration among Muslims throughout the ages.
